WebA Simplified Employee Pension (SEP) IRA is a plan completely funded by the employer. This plan benefits both the employer and employees, with tax-deductible contributions for the employer and tax-deferred growth for the employees. Flexibility over contributions makes it a good choice for businesses with varying profits.
